Abstract

The specific proposal is to develop and pilot a cross sector senior leadership programme, across statutory and third sector in social care. Currently, there is no cross sector senior leadership programme specific to social care. This programme will sit within a framework of national management programmes which is managed for the 22 local authorities by Social Care Wales. Within the framework we have: - Team Manager Development programme (accredited) - Middle Manager Development Programme (accredited) - Developmental programmes for senior leaders (non accredited) This programme would sit at the developmental programmes for senior leaders level. The purpose of this pilot would be to test a collective leadership programme, with a long term aim that the programme would likely be offered every two years, or more frequently depending on demand. There is potential that the eligibility criteria may expand for future cohorts, to include partners such as health. This programme seeks to bring together learning opportunities across sectors, linking to our commitments in our workforce strategy for collective and compassionate leadership in social care. The principles of the programme would be based in compassionate leadership. The objective of the project is to support senior leaders across statutory and third sector to create a culture of continuous change and improvement across social care by: - Establishing a programme that will support senior leaders' personal development, learning and resilience. - Provide senior leaders with opportunities to work together across boundaries to coproduce and implement solutions for change and improvement in social care - Improve understanding and appreciation of collective leadership challenges - Build sustainable peer to peer relationships - Support leaders to develop their confidence and resilience and achieve what matters to supported individuals and communities. *Please download the ITT for further information and detail*

2.4

Total quantity or scope of tender

The contract will run initially until March 2024 with a possibility of being extended for a further six months, up to a total period of 2 years.

There is a budget of £45,000 (inclusive of any applicable VAT) agreed for this tender.

3 Conditions for Participation

3.1

Minimum standards and qualification required

The successful bidder would need to demonstrate experience of:

- working with and developing senior leaders

- identifying and working with current and relevant examples of good practice

- knowledge of the social care sector in Wales, including national policy and strategic priorities, and current pressures and challenges. This would include an understanding of both third and public sector.
